You can get some better luck using Accelerator to get dumps:
https://forums.alliedmods.net/showpost.php?p=1952983postcount=136
Or you can try launching your servers with -nobreakpad so that the crash
dumps don't get consumed by Valve's breakpad handler.

We've released updates for TF2, CS:S, DoD:S, and HL2:DM that fix a case where
some clients/servers were crashing during map load. This is not a required
update for dedicated servers, but if you think you're having a problem during
map load you should download the update.
